Compare all specifications:

1971 Alpine A 110 1985 Ferrari 208
Make Alpine Ferrari
Model A 110 208
Year Released 1971 1985
Engine Position Rear Middle
Engine Size 1606 cc 1990 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 8 cylinders
Engine Type in-line V
Horse Power 127 HP 217 HP
Engine RPM 6250 RPM 7000 RPM
Torque 146 Nm 240 Nm
Torque RPM 5000 RPM 4800 RPM
Drive Type Rear Rear
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Number of Seats 2 seats 2 seats
Number of Doors 2 doors 2 doors
Vehicle Length 3860 mm 4240 mm
Vehicle Width 1560 mm 1730 mm
Vehicle Height 1120 mm 1130 mm
Wheelbase Size 2140 mm 2350 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 38 L 74 L
